  1. This is a thing of beauty Spinners! Don't tease us with this!! It's a shame they had almost no air to air capacity in actual service. I know they undertook trials for the USAF with the AIM-7, but as far as I've been able to find out, they rarely, if ever carried AIM-9s. A high/low mixture of IIOs and the F-4E would have been a massive capability boost over the Mirage IIIO's barely functional AIM-9Bs and surprisingly short ranged Matra R530s and their 50/50 chance to hit from 10kms and out. Even with AIM-7Es, the Phantom would have provided an actual air defence capability in the 70s! I love it!

  12. I think quite a few aircraft have something like HasFireExtinguisher=True, depending on the specific type and era. I don't know how effective it is or if it works at all, but more often than not, I'm using cannon, not MGs, in a gunfight. Cannons are ruthlessly efficient in the TW series make armor somewhat redundant. If you're using MGs though, you might see extinguishers come into play more effectively, assuming of course that it's working. Have a look through the engine spec in the DATA.ini of different aircraft and you see if it has that capacity. I'm pretty sure more modern multi-engine aircraft, particularly transports will have these in their engine specs.
  13. Burst amount is just the number of rounds a gun turret fire in a single burst, it's not applicable to the pilot's guns. As for incendiary, to the best of my knowledge, incendiary isn't recognised unfortunately. Someone may have figured a work around though... maybe.

  21. Back in '85 when I was a wee munchkin, I got to witness a pair of Mirage IIIOFs do this and it's silence was what really made an impression on me the most. Being 5yrs old and not knowing how sound worked, to see all these people at the airshow covering their ears at the very fast, very silent dart threw me. Then the sound hit and I entered a world of pain. Poor pilots got into a tonne of trouble when the moment of transonic flight made it on the news and several glass houses on nearby farms were completely demolished during their flypast.
